Overcharged at 5424 Antoine drive suite B store number 8 Houston Tx. 77091

A1 Check Cashing - Overcharged at 5424 Antoine drive suite B store number 8 Houston Tx. 77091
Have reason to believe this company display false advertisment.Due to sign of 1%check cashing does not specify which check out of God only knows how many there are except payroll.The sign doesn't even say what kinds of checks.The consumer only learns this after a 10min. wait to process.The teller/manager called me back to the window then slide an envelope thru the little hole. Not counting the money in front of me. So I counted it in front of him,to find out out of $1,861.56 check counted $1,630.which means he deducted $231.56.Denied the Right to Cancel when I ask for my check back sliding the money back in the lil hole. The manager responded " you can go to their website to file a complaint." "You can call the police." Once they get your check behind that glass it's then confiscated by their employees.They will not give it back to the owner..What give them the Right to go in the money that intended for myself from my insurance company. User's recommendation: Ask the names or number of the different checks s they cash and which applies to the 1%rule and which checks have another rule.Warning you will have the Right to refuse/ Cancelation denied.
